This EXTOL PREMIUM cordless compressor is designed to check and replenish tire pressure for passenger and commercial vehicles, motorcycles, and bicycles, as well as to inflate sports balls, mattresses, pool loungers, and more. Equipped with a 20V Li-ion battery, our high-performance cordless air compressor for tires delivers a maximum pressure of 11 bar/1100 kPa/160 PSI. Its battery charges in approximately 55 minutes, allowing you to get back to work quickly. And its user-friendly display enables you to choose the pressure in bar, psi, and kPa, with the added convenience of automatic switch-off when the set pressure is reached. The metal construction of this cordless air compressor for tires ensures durability and long service life, while its lightweight design and portability make it easy to carry and maneuver. And the backlit display and integrated light make it simple even in low-light conditions. Moreover, safety is a top priority with the air compressor. Its switch features a self-starting safety device and a lock to keep the switch in the ON position during use. The Li-ion batteries can also be charged anytime without decreasing capacity, ensuring you’re always ready to tackle any inflation task. Please note that the battery and charger are sold separately.
